In case anyone missed it, it's confirmed that Management Mode is being pushed back in order to focus on getting the PS4 release in order. Also, the UI is getting an overhaul. twitter.com/sc_prowrestling/status/978587181458472960My biggest concern about this is what this means to what will be included on the disc of the PS4 version. Is Management Mode getting pushed back until after August when the game is released on PS4, or just getting pushed back until the PS4 version is tight enough to move on to that mode? Is it going to be on the disc with the game? Because if it's going to be DLC, paying more to have that in the game may cause people to balk at the high price of the release, which could hurt the series. I'm hoping we get some answers soon. I'm also still concerned how wrestlers and items that were created in workshop are going to translate to the PS4? Has there been any solid answers to how that will work on PS4? Is there any other games that are on both Steam and PS4 that are able to share workshop items between the two platforms?

Post by Heeltown, USA on Apr 30, 2018 20:01:34 GMT -5
Is there a simple enough guide to installing mods for this game?? Somebody made youtube video awhile back taking you through it. CarlZilla’s mods are a breeze to install. All you have to do is unzip the files to your directory. And every time SC updates the game you have to wait for Carl to update the mod suite, but he generally has that ready mere hours later. The moves added in are great, there is a 173 of them. What really is tittie sprinkles is his bigger movesets mod. A wrestler can have over a 1,000 moves with that thing. It makes the matches way better.
